You can change the endpoints to match your actual IP of the machines, and then you can add certSANs. It's not clear from your question how you got into this, Talos automatically manages certSANs. |

When I do talosctl dashboard i get:
error copying: rpc error: code = Unavailable desc = connection error: desc = "transport: authentication handshake failed: tls: failed to verify certificate: x509: certificate is valid for 10.161.18.196, 192.168.0.61, 192.168.0.99, not 10.161.18.51"
I have the secrets.yaml. Is there a way to change the SAN to that new ip? Or how could i get access to my talos cluster again?
